    Its a VW T3 motor lid, id lyin about, looks ok to me.

    We are now about to join our lower rear quarters, to our new spare wheel well, thus the rear end will be done completely construction wise, we need to sort a fuel neck as our amazon was opposite side to our bmw, volvo one is now blanked off and we need an idea, but well cross it as and when,

    Our motor will be back soon so we can play around with it, it is been mated to an M3 trans, we need to make some motor mounts, should be easy,

    Also i need some wings on back order, supposed to be end of september now end of year ?
